DESCRIPTION:Women in STEM and Entrepreneurship grants encourage participation of girls and women in science\, technology\, engineering and mathematics leading to STEM education and careers. \nWhat do you get?\nGrants between $1\,000\,000 and $2\,000\,000 for projects that increase women’s and girls’ participation in STEM and entrepreneurship. \nWho is this for?\nAustralian businesses\, publicly funded research organisations\, vocational education and training providers\, TAFE institutions and not-for-profit organisations to deliver projects that support women and girls to build STEM skills and succeed in STEM education and careers. \nAbout the program\nThe Women in STEM and Entrepreneurship program supports investment in gender equity initiatives that aim for lasting systemic change by eliminating barriers for women’s participation in STEM education and careers\, and entrepreneurship. \nThe grant opportunity provides funding to deliver co-designed projects that: \n\nreduce and/or mitigate systemic and cultural barriers to participation in STEM education\, careers\, innovation and entrepreneurship by girls and women\nreduce the multiplier effect of intersectional barriers to participation\, development and leadership of girls and women in STEM education\, careers\, innovation and entrepreneurship\naddress inequality or discrimination against girls and women in STEM education\, careers\, innovation and/or entrepreneurship\, by either:\n\nincreasing awareness and understanding of the barriers to participation of girls and women in STEM education\, careers\, innovation and/or entrepreneurship\nincreasing participation\, development and leadership of girls and women in STEM education\, careers\, innovation and entrepreneurship\, including senior leadership and decision-making positions in government\, research organisations\, industry and businesses\nbroadening and strengthening networks and support for girls and women in STEM education\, careers\, innovation and entrepreneurship.

DESCRIPTION:Build It or Kill It is a CORE Connect event designed to help founders\, operators and industry partners sense-check real ideas before investing more time\, money or energy. \nA small number of participants will put forward an idea they are genuinely unsure about\, and the room will work through it together — pressure-testing assumptions from customer\, buyer\, operator and funding perspectives. \nThis is not a pitch night and there is no winner; the goal is clarity. \nAttendees will gain practical insight into how ideas are evaluated in the real world\, contribute their experience\, and build meaningful connections through honest\, useful conversation.

DESCRIPTION:What are investors looking for in 2026?  \n​The bar for capital raising has never been higher. With greater competition\, and AI making timelines from MVP to market much faster\, the funding landscape for 2026 looks very different from even a few years ago. For funding\, this means increased selectivity\, heightened due diligence and a focus on clear pathways to revenue\, adding new pressure for founders. \n​So what do founders need to know?
